Hebe was found with 2 other siblings wandering on the streets begging for food and scavenging scraps to survive. When they reach the age of teething, they seek out the locals’ shoes to chew on. The rescuers could only take Hebe at the moment. Hebe is very affectionate towards people. Her favourite thing to do is belly-flopping on the ground asking for you to give her a good belly rub! She is such a sweet girl! Different from the stereotypical image of beagles, Hebe is quiet and submissive, and low in energy. She likes to run and sniff other dogs but she seems to be very submissive in the doggo social circle. This makes Hebe an easy target to be bullied. Her temperament is so soft and sweet that she just belly flops and let other dogs stand on top of her. She’s so easy going on leash that even a child can handle her! Melody was found under the stairs in a neighbourhood complex entrance together with her mother and brother. The rescuer took the mother and the brother in for fostering. She is introverted and slow to open, but once she does, she is affectionate towards people. She’s very agreeable when interacting in the pack of 30 dogs and is peaceful and confident.

Nina was found abandoned in the park, unspayed. After the TNR (trap, neuter, and return), she stayed in the area but was very attached to people. She often chases cars in desperation to “go home” with the humans. The neighbours complained and threatened to poison her, so the rescuer took her back and place her in a foster home.
Nina is generally very happy and affectionate. She is low to medium energy. She may need a few minutes to warm up to strangers but after that, she’s extremely affectionate and loving.

Isia was abandoned at the traditional market in central Taiwan. When she was trapped for spaying, the rescuer sees how friendly and affectionate she is, and decided that she should be in a home where Isia can get the love and attention she deserves! Isia tends to stay low for the first 2 days in a new environment, and will come out and play when she understands she’s safe! Be ready for the fun you can have with this gal!
At the foster’s she goes out 3 times a day and she does not go potty indoors. She loves playing chases with other dogs.
